The big box stores already have had opticians' offices for many years, and have announced intent to open drop-in medical offices. Additionally, many supermarkets now have bank branches in their stores. Why not self-owned banks?
It can be a great service to shoppers. Many Wal-Marts also have grocery sections, so a family can take care of all of its needs under one roof. This is comfortably convenient when the weather outside is extremely hot or full of ice-covered roads. The bank availability could also reduce the need to carry large sums of money to go shopping and/or overuse of costly credit cards.
There may be some drawbacks to Wal-Mart banking, depending on a store's location. An all-inclusive big box coming into a community has a history of devastating effects on nearby small retailers. If the Wal-Mart also provides medical and banking services, it could have the same impact on local physicians, hospitals and financial institutions.
